Diffusion is best described as the passive movement of molecules from an area of high concentration to an area of low concentration. This process occurs because molecules are constantly moving and colliding with each other, leading to a net movement in the direction that results in equal distribution. This concept aligns with the principles of entropy, where systems tend to move toward a state of greater disorder or equilibrium.

The term "passive" is important because it indicates that diffusion does not require energy input; it happens naturally due to the kinetic energy of the molecules involved. This distinguishes diffusion from other forms of transport, such as active transport, which requires energy to move substances against their concentration gradient.
